Ingredients You’ll Need
Let’s talk about how just a handful of staple ingredients can create pure snack magic. Each component in No Bake Chocolate Chip Cookie Balls brings something special to the table, whether it’s flavor, texture, or that crave-worthy pop of chocolate.
- Rolled oats: These form the hearty, wholesome base and give each ball that classic chewy bite.
- Almond butter or peanut butter: Nut butter binds the ingredients together and adds rich, creamy flavor. Go for your favorite for a personal touch.
- Honey or maple syrup: A natural sweetener that helps everything stick while providing a lovely, mellow sweetness.
- Vanilla extract: Just a splash brings all the flavors together and adds warm, aromatic notes.
- Salt: A pinch is all you need to brighten up the sweetness and balance the chocolatey richness.
- Mini chocolate chips: These little bursts of chocolate ensure you get a bit of melty magic in every bite.
- Finely chopped nuts or shredded coconut (optional): Stir these in for a little extra crunch, nuttiness, or tropical flair, depending on your mood.
How to Make No Bake Chocolate Chip Cookie Balls
Step 1: Mix the Base Ingredients
Start by adding your rolled oats, almond butter (or peanut butter), honey (or maple syrup), vanilla extract, and salt to a medium mixing bowl. Use a sturdy spoon or spatula to stir everything together. The result should be a thick, slightly sticky dough that easily holds its shape—this is the foundation for your No Bake Chocolate Chip Cookie Balls and sets the stage for all that yummy chocolatey goodness.
Step 2: Add the Fun Extras
Fold in your mini chocolate chips and, if using, finely chopped nuts or shredded coconut. Mixing by hand at this stage ensures your chocolate chips and add-ins are evenly spread throughout the mixture, so every ball gets its fair share of mix-ins.
Step 3: Shape the Balls
Now comes the fun and slightly messy part: shaping your dough into 1-inch balls. You can use a small cookie scoop for even portions or just dive in with clean hands and roll the mixture into bite-sized rounds. Place each ball on a parchment-lined tray as you go—don’t worry if they aren’t perfectly uniform, that homemade look is part of their charm!
Step 4: Chill and Set
To firm up the texture, pop your tray of cookie balls in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es. This quick chill helps the flavors meld, and it makes the No Bake Chocolate Chip Cookie Balls easier to handle. Once set, you can enjoy them right away or pop them into an airtight container for snacks throughout the week.

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
Once chilled, store your No Bake Chocolate Chip Cookie Balls in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They’ll stay fresh and delicious for up to one week, making them perfect for grab-and-go snacking at home or at work.
Freezing
If you want to plan ahead, these cookie balls freeze beautifully. Arrange them in a single layer in a freezer-safe container or zip-top bag, then store for up to three months. Simply thaw in the fridge for a few hours before enjoying, and they’ll taste just as fresh as the day you made them.
Reheating
There’s really no need to reheat these No Bake Chocolate Chip Cookie Balls since they’re meant to be enjoyed chilled or at room temperature. If they’re a little too firm straight from the freezer, let them sit out for about 10 minutes to soften up before snacking.
FAQs
Can I use quick oats instead of rolled oats?
Yes, quick oats work in a pinch and will make the balls a bit softer; if you want more texture, stick with rolled oats.
Are No Bake Chocolate Chip Cookie Balls gluten-free?
They absolutely can be! Just use certified gluten-free oats, and these treats will be safe for anyone avoiding gluten.
Can I make these nut-free?
Yes! Swap the almond or peanut butter for sunflower seed butter, and skip the nuts—your No Bake Chocolate Chip Cookie Balls will still taste fantastic.
What’s the best way to mix the dough if it seems too dry or too sticky?
If your mixture feels dry, add an extra spoonful of nut butter or sweetener; if it’s too sticky to handle, a sprinkle of oats or some ground flaxseed will bring it together nicely.
Can I double or triple the recipe?
Absolutely—these are perfect for meal prep! Just increase the ingredient quantities proportionally, and you’ll have a big batch ready to fuel your week or share with friends.

PrintNo Bake Chocolate Chip Cookie Balls Recipe
These No Bake Chocolate Chip Cookie Balls are a delicious and easy-to-make snack or treat. Packed with oats, almond butter, and sweetened with honey, they are a healthier alternative to traditional cookies.
- Prep Time: 10 minutes
- Cook Time: 0 minutes
- Total Time: 10 minutes (plus chilling time)
- Yield: 12 balls 1x
- Category: Snack
- Method: No Bake
- Cuisine: American
- Diet: Gluten Free, Vegetarian
Ingredients
Rolled Oats:
1 cup
Almond Butter or Peanut Butter:
1/2 cup
Honey or Maple Syrup:
1/3 cup
Vanilla Extract:
1/2 teaspoon
Salt:
1/4 teaspoon
Mini Chocolate Chips:
1/3 cup
Finely Chopped Nuts or Shredded Coconut (optional):
1/4 cup
Instructions
- Combine Ingredients: In a medium bowl, mix rolled oats, almond butter, honey, vanilla extract, and salt until well combined.
- Add Chocolate Chips: Fold in chocolate chips and optional nuts or coconut.
- Form Balls: Roll mixture into 1-inch balls using hands or a scoop.
- Chill: Place balls on a tray, refrigerate for at least 30 minutes.
- Enjoy: Store in the fridge and serve chilled.
Notes
- For a firmer texture, add ground flaxseed or chia seeds.
- Substitute sunflower seed butter for a nut-free version.
- Perfect for a quick snack or lunchbox treat.
